Speech

Before Feeling Good Bellamy "Sun is like a spoon, [?] like I had, could make a good man bad".

Matthew Bellamy's speech may have been a verse from the song Please Please Please, Let Me Get What I Want by The Smiths that Muse later covered.

Good times for a change
See, the luck I’ve had
Can make a good man
Turn bad
